Introduction: Headquartered in Betzdorf, Luxembourg, SES S.A. is one of Europe’s premier satellite communications operators. It controls a global fleet of GEO and MEO satellites and a specialized government division (SES Space & Defense) dedicated to secure connectivity.
In recent years SES has positioned itself at the forefront of Europe’s drive for secure multi-orbit connectivity: it led the SpaceRISE consortium awarded the EU’s IRIS² contract (multi-orbit secure network) and is expanding its O3b mPOWER MEO capacity into a NATO-backed service (the NSPA MEO Global Services program).
